Summary

In this role, you will lead the strategy, roadmap, and execution for enterprise platform products that enable scalable, secure, and AI-first software delivery. You will partner with engineering, architecture, AI Delivery, security, and product leadership to define platform investment priorities, drive cross-functional alignment, and deliver platform capabilities that improve developer productivity, governance, adoption, and delivery outcomes. You will influence enterprise technology decisions, guide platform product practices, and develop a high-performing team while fostering a modern, AI-enabled product management approach.

Responsibilities
  • Define and communicate the strategic vision, roadmap, and investment priorities for enterprise platform products.
  • Own the platform strategy for reusable rules, workflows, decisioning, routing, approvals, and orchestration capabilities that enable internal products and AI-enabled tools to move from insight to action.
  • Lead the strategy, roadmap, and evolution of workflow platforms, rules engines, business process automation, decisioning logic, orchestration, configuration platforms, and AI workflow enablement capabilities that support enterprise-scale solutions.
  • Partner with engineering, architecture, AI Delivery, security, and product leadership to align platform capabilities with business and technology objectives and drive complex stakeholder alignment.
  • Establish clear decision frameworks for sequencing platform capabilities, reducing technical debt, increasing platform reuse, improving internal developer productivity, and enabling AI-assisted development initiatives.
  • Measure and optimize platform success through outcomes such as platform adoption, governance, delivery efficiency, reduced delivery friction, faster product delivery, and AI-first delivery maturity.
  • Facilitate executive stakeholder alignment on platform strategy, funding, dependencies, adoption expectations, and AI-first operating model evolution while translating complex technical concepts into business-focused recommendations.
  • Resolve competing priorities across platform consumers, engineering teams, AI Delivery, and strategic enterprise initiatives.
  • Lead and develop a small team of platform product professionals through coaching, mentoring, and performance development while establishing scalable product management standards, including discovery practices, roadmap development, success metrics, release planning, adoption strategies, and responsible AI tool usage.
  • Build durable partnerships across engineering, architecture, AI Delivery, security, design, and internal product teams to deliver enterprise platform capabilities.
Qualifications
  • Relevant degree preferred.
  • 7 or more years of relevant experience required.
  • Experience in product management, technical product management, enterprise platform products, workflow platforms, rules engines, orchestration platforms, business process automation, decisioning logic, configuration platforms, enterprise SaaS, AI workflow enablement, or enterprise technology leadership.
  • Proven success leading complex cross-functional platform initiatives and influencing senior stakeholders through complex stakeholder alignment.
  • Experience delivering enterprise platform capabilities that support reusable workflows, human-in-the-loop workflows, routing, approvals, orchestration, and decisioning across multiple products.
  • Strong technical fluency with architecture, data platforms, AI, integrations, identity and access management, governance, internal developer platforms, and AI-assisted or agentic development practices.
  • Demonstrated ability to coach product managers on modern product management practices and effective AI tool adoption without creating unnecessary process overhead.
  • Experience influencing investment priorities, technical tradeoffs, internal adoption strategies, and AI-first operating model decisions.
  • Strong analytical, strategic thinking, problem-solving, and executive communication skills.
  • Experience developing scalable product management practices while maintaining a lean, high-impact operating model.
